WebRequired documents: The state of New Mexico requires businesses to file Articles of Incorporation as well as a Statement of Acceptance of Appointment by Designated Initial Registered Agent. Turnaround time: In general, turnaround time for incorporating a business in New Mexico is 10-15 business days. Follow-up filings: Required. FORM NAME: Articles of Incorporation FILING FEE: $25 FOR ADDITIONAL INFORMATION: http://www.sos.state.nm.us/ WebEach state has its own personnel requirements for incorporating. In New Mexico, your corporation must meet the following requirements: Age requirement: There is no minimum age requirement for directors. Number of directors: At least one director is required. Officers: There must be a president, secretary and treasurer.

Blackdom was located fifteen miles south of Roswell. The town was incorporated in 1903 by thirteen African Americans. This group formed the Blackdom Townsite Company with $10,000 in combined assets.
